Lets compare vitamin content per 1 kilogram of Broccoli Raab vs Balsam-pear , Pods:
- 1 kilogram of Broccoli Raab has 5.5 times more Vitamin A, 4.1 times more Vitamin B1, 3.2 times more Vitamin B2, 3.1 times more Vitamin B3, 1.5 times more Vitamin B5 and 4 times more Vitamin B6 than Balsam-pear , Pods.
- While 1 kg of Raw Balsam-pear , Pods contains 4.2 times more Vitamin C than Raw Broccoli Raab.
- Both Broccoli Raab and Balsam-pear , Pods provide similar amounts of Vitamin B9 per one kilogram.
- Both Raw Broccoli Raab as well as Raw Balsam-pear , Pods have insufficient amounts of Vitamin B12 and Vitamin D in one kilogram.
Comparing minerals per 1 kilogram for Broccoli Raab vs Balsam-pear , Pods:
- 1 kilogram of Broccoli Raab has 5.7 times more Calcium, 1.2 times more Copper, 5 times more Iron, 1.3 times more Magnesium, 4.4 times more Manganese, 2.4 times more Phosphorus and 6.6 times more Sodium than Balsam-pear , Pods.
- While 1 kg of Raw Balsam-pear , Pods contains 1.5 times more Potassium than Raw Broccoli Raab.
- Both Broccoli Raab and Balsam-pear , Pods contain similar levels of Zinc and Water per one kilogram.

Comparison of macro-nutrients per 1 kilogram:
- 1 kilogram of Broccoli Raab has 3.2 times more Protein than Balsam-pear , Pods.
- While 1 kg of Raw Balsam-pear , Pods contains 1.3 times more Carbohydrate than Raw Broccoli Raab.
- Both Broccoli Raab and Balsam-pear , Pods offer comparable quantities of Fiber per one kilogram.
